Make: install: команда не найдена

Пока я пытаюсь установить git из своего источника на qnx, я получаю следующую ошибку (обратите внимание, что pound - это приглашение для sudo в qnx):

# ./configure --without-iconv --with-perl=/usr/pkg/bin/perl --with-python=/usr/qnx650/host/qnx6/x86/usr/bin/python
# make all
# make install
 GEN perl/PM.stamp
 SUBDIR gitweb
 SUBDIR ../
make[2]: `GIT-VERSION-FILE' is up to date.
 GEN git-instaweb
 SUBDIR git-gui
 SUBDIR gitk-git
 SUBDIR perl
 SUBDIR git_remote_helpers
 SUBDIR templates
install -d -m 755 '/usr/local/bin'
make: install: Command not found
make: *** [install] Error 127

Я видел много проблем make: %XXX%: Command not found в Googling, где %XXX% является произвольным исполняемым, но не видел его замененным на install. Что не так?

Я разместил несколько файлов возможного интереса от домашнего каталога git: Makefile, config.status

qnx 6.5.0 SDP SP1, git 1.8.3.2

1 ответ

В make файле нет проблем. Проверьте, есть ли утилита install

$~ install --help

Если у вас его нет, вы можете получить его от GNU coreutils. Если у вас есть install где-то, то экспортируйте его путь в переменную PATH

export PATH=$PATH:/path/to/install-utility

licensed under cc by-sa 3.0 with attribution.